Output ef3a79fe63f78719815edebe6786c20dfb45e5eed7830c909054209450287c6e:3

value
2028150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cfdd82b6d03bc6f74f8e2f0a1f6921e6a03776d OP_EQUAL
address
3JvK42WdfYmqxzBMaXwQTThqayAXraCBX6
transaction
ef3a79fe63f78719815edebe6786c20dfb45e5eed7830c909054209450287c6e
spent
true